    Plant Care & Growing Tips

    Growing beautiful Baby Blue Eyes from Nemophila Menziesii seeds is a straightforward and rewarding process. These annuals are quite adaptable, but providing them with optimal conditions will ensure the most prolific and vibrant blooms. You can plant these baby blue eyes seeds directly outdoors after the danger of frost has passed, or start them indoors several weeks before the last frost for an earlier bloom.

    For sunlight, Baby Blue Eyes thrive in conditions ranging from partial shade to part sun. In hotter climates, some afternoon shade can be beneficial to protect the delicate flowers from scorching. They are not particularly fussy about soil, preferring average, well-draining soil. Avoid heavy, waterlogged conditions, as this can lead to root rot. Consistent moisture is appreciated, especially during dry spells, but ensure the soil is never soggy. Water deeply when the top inch of soil feels dry to the touch. While they are hardy enough to reseed in many zones, they are typically considered annuals, meaning they complete their life cycle in one growing season. They do not require heavy fertilization; a balanced, all-purpose fertilizer applied sparingly during the growing season is usually sufficient, or simply enriching the soil with compost before planting. Keep an eye out for common garden pests, though Nemophila Menziesii is generally quite robust. Proper spacing of 6-12 inches between plants will allow for good air circulation and healthy growth, helping to prevent fungal issues.

    When starting your fragrant flower seeds indoors, sow them in seed-starting mix, lightly covering them. Keep the soil consistently moist and provide plenty of light. Once seedlings are strong enough and all danger of frost has passed, gradually acclimatize them to outdoor conditions before transplanting. These annual flower seeds will typically bloom in spring, bringing a wave of beautiful blue to your garden beds.
